Mothering Sunday – 19th March

This fourth Sunday in Lent is Mothering Sunday, a tradition less well known in Australia than “Mother’s Day” in May, but a good opportunity for us to acknowledge mothers and mother figures among us. About Lent – Sunday 26th February

By Sean MacEntee - Holy Cross at Sunrise

This is the first Sunday in Lent, a season which has a very long history in the Christian church.  Because Easter is the central event of the church year, the lead up to Easter is an important time of preparation.  Lent might at first have been for new Christians to reflect, pray and discipline themselves […]
